ROCModels: ROC Models and AUC Estimation
The receiver operating characteristic (ROC) curve is one of the most widely used tools for evaluating diagnostic and prognostic biomarkers across diverse scientific fields, particularly in medicine. Despite its ubiquity, ROC estimation and testing methods differ substantially in their assumptions and resulting curve properties. This package provides a unified framework for constructing, visualizing, and comparing parametric, nonparametric, semiparametric, and Bayesian ROC curves. 'ROCModels' helps researchers identify and implement ROC inference methods most suitable for their data. See the accompanying vignette 'ROCModels_Package_Doc' for a detailed introduction. Alonzo, T.
